Hoshiarpur, August 21

Advertisement

A review meeting of ‘Beti Bachao-Beti Padhao’ scheme was held under the chairmanship of Deputy Commissioner Komal Mittal, in which officials of various departments participated. The Deputy Commissioner took several important decisions during the meeting. He said that tree plantation will be done in the name of newborn girls in 10 blocks of the district.

Advertisement

The initiative will be a symbol of promoting environmental protection as well as respect for newborn girls in the district.

Apart from this, free driving training and free coaching classes will be held for girls. The DC said that the aim of these programmes is to make girls and women self-reliant and provide them with the necessary skills to become independent.

Mittal also said that more and women should be encouraged to participate in the mega employment fair being organised by the District Employment and Business Bureau on August 27.

Advertisement

The employment fair will provide new job opportunities to women, which will help in empowering them economically.

District Programme Officer Hardeep Kaur, District Development Fellow Zoya Siddiqui, Assistant Civil Surgeon Dr Kamlesh, Assistant Director, Youth Services, Preet Kohli, Deputy District Education Officer Dheeraj Vashisht, District Employment Officer Sanjeev Kumar and Child Development Project Officer, besides officials from other departments were also present on the occasion.
